About MemSQL

MemSQL is a distributed, in-memory data warehouse that lets you process transactions and run analytics in real-time, using SQL. Download now and see how it works.

About MongoDB Atlas

A cloud MongoDB service built for developers who want to spend more time building apps and less time managing databases. Compatible with Amazon AWS, Microsoft Azure, and Google Cloud Platform.

Can Integrate.io sync MemSQL data to MongoDB Atlas?

Yes. Integrate.io helps teams build managed pipelines that move MemSQL data into MongoDB Atlas for analytics, operations, and reporting workflows.

What MemSQL data can I move to MongoDB Atlas?

The available MemSQL data depends on the connector, authentication, API permissions, and objects selected. Integrate.io helps map that data into MongoDB Atlas fields and tables.

Can I transform MemSQL data before it lands in MongoDB Atlas?

Yes. Integrate.io supports mapping, filtering, joins, enrichment, scheduling, monitoring, and error handling before MemSQL data reaches MongoDB Atlas.

How often can Integrate.io refresh MemSQL data in MongoDB Atlas?

Refresh timing depends on source limits, destination capacity, data volume, and business requirements. Teams can configure schedules that keep MongoDB Atlas updated from MemSQL.

Do I need custom code for a MemSQL to MongoDB Atlas pipeline?

Most MemSQL to MongoDB Atlas pipelines can be configured visually in Integrate.io. Teams can add advanced logic when the integration requires API-specific handling or custom transformations.

How do I validate a MemSQL to MongoDB Atlas integration?

Start with a scoped MemSQL sync, confirm field mapping and row counts in MongoDB Atlas, review pipeline logs, then schedule the production workflow once the data matches expectations.
